Amazon Prime automatically converts 30-day trial memberships to a paid membership at the end of your free trial.
In my case this term & condition was hidden away at the end of a long boring acknowledgement email.
€92 was deducted from my account using my Amazon buyer/seller payment details.
No notification before, or receipt after, this transaction.
When I called Amazon they said refund would only be effected in "7 working days".
Like most people I have important bills to pay each middle and end of month.
The bank never allows me to draw money from the same account used to pay Amazon when I have insufficient funds. In fact even where funds exist in the account it is not uncommon to have payment refusals at petrol stations due to network or maintenance issues at the bank system then.
I find it very strange that at the time when the Amazon Prime payment was effected there actually was not enough funds in my account to meet the €92 demanded.
Yet the bank went ahead and put my account overdrawn to pay the Amazon Prime demand.
Many questions arise in this situation.
But one question embraces them all.
Does any body regulate e-commerce in Ireland ?
